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Appley Bridge to Halesworth start from as little as £49.10

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Appley Bridge to Halesworth are available for £130.30 one way, or £200.90 return

Facilities and Amenities at Appley Bridge Station

Though Appley Bridge lacks a ticket office, worry not, as ticket machines are available for collecting your tickets. It’s worth noting that while you can collect your tickets directly from these machines, they are not accessible for everyone. An induction loop is in place to assist those with hearing difficulties. Despite the absence of smartcard facilities, the absence of ticket barriers ensures easy platform access.

The station offers partial step-free access. This convenience, coupled with the presence of boarding ramps on trains, ensures passengers with mobility issues are well catered for. However, it’s advisable to check the detailed route layout via the 360 map for more accessible route options.

While there are no staff members to assist, a helpline is available if help is needed. CCTV is operational, and seating areas are available for your comfort. Keep in mind that neither toilets nor refreshment facilities are available, so plan accordingly before your trip. There are 15 free parking spaces, but none are designated for disabled access, so do plan accordingly.

Transport Links at Appley Bridge

If you’re planning to continue your journey from Appley Bridge Station, several travel options are at your disposal. While there are no local bus services directly from the station itself, buses for rail replacement services can be found at the nearby station approach on Appley Lane North. For those looking to book a taxi, relevant services can be accessed through the Northern Railway website. It's advised to arrange these services ahead of your visit.

No bicycle hire facilities are present, though cycle storage is available for personal bikes. Five bicycle lockers are within the car park, equipped with CCTV, providing a secure option for cycling enthusiasts.

Facilities and Ticketing at Halesworth Station

While Halesworth Station lacks the traditional ticket office, it ensures ease of travel with ticket machines that allow passengers to collect pre-purchased tickets as well as buy new ones on the spot. For those using online-savvy smartcards, the station is equipped with smartcard validators ready for use. Accessibility is a key feature of the station, as there are accessible ticket machines and induction loops for hard-of-hearing travelers. However, it should be noted that the station does not provide waiting rooms or lounge services, and amenities like shops or refreshment facilities are absent, promising a no-fuss, straightforward travel experience.

Transport Links from Halesworth

Reaching further than the platforms are the various transport connections available at Halesworth. Rail replacement bus services operate from Bramblewood Way, conveniently situated just behind Platform 1. Even without accessible taxis at the station premises, other modes of transport like local buses and potential car hires cater to a variety of travel plans. Moreover, for cyclists, the station provides ample bicycle storage options, ensuring cyclists find safe stowing for their two-wheelers during their rail-bound travel escapades.
